WebManchester Tank continues to do its part to protect the environment from the harmful hydrofluorocarbons (HFCs) and chlorofluorocarbons (CFCs) that if left unchecked or … WebAn air receiver tank is an important component of a compressed air system. The tank is sized 6 – 10 times the flow rate of the compressor system. The receiver tank is usually 150 cubic feet (minimum) for compressors with a rating of 25 scfm at 100 psi. The tank is a reservoir of compressed air that can be used during peak demand. location of bob\u0027s furniture https://cleanestrooms.com

Stack Exchange network consists of … WebJun 22, 2024 · R-22 is an HCFC refrigerant and can harm the Ozone layer. It was originally invented by a partnership with General Motors and the DuPont company all the way back in the 1930’s. These new CFC and HCFC refrigerants were known under the DuPont brand name Freon. R-22, along with it’s sister product R-12, were one of the first mainstream ...
